Lily Cup
As thin as a tampon, but better. Lily Cup is a gamechanger! Thanks to its angled form that complements your anatomy, Lily Cup is the only cup that can be rolled as thin as a tampon. It’s perfect for those who have a higher cervix or heavier flow while it offers complete comfort all period long. Its incredibly smooth design and slanted rim allow you to use this menstrual cup for up to 12 hours without worries.
If you haven’t given birth or you gave birth by caesarean, this is a perfect size for you. This size is perfect for those of you who have a medium flow.

“i’ve been using the lily cup for the past 3.5 years and it’s not only saved me hundreds of dollars in tampons, but also has worked better than tampons ever could! there’s no leaking, no spotting, i can go a full workday without worrying about bleeding through or having to change it, i can swim, exercise, sleep with it in, etc. etc. i genuinely forget i’m on my period except for when i take it out twice a day (12 hours is the max time to keep it in; i change it usually during my morning shower and before bed lol). no more worrying that you don’t have enough tampons/pads for a trip! such a genuine life changer. when i was first trying out cups, i went through two other brands before i tried the lily cup— the other two were the more standard bell shape and they felt too wide, bulky, hard to insert, and felt like they sat too low in my vaginal canal. the difference was night and day the second i tried the lily cup :) the angled/narrow shape is much better suited to my (and i feel like most people’s?) anatomy and sooooo much more comfortable than alternatives! the only criticism i have is that i have. no idea. why they manufacture it exclusively in light pink. obviously it can be cleaned and sterilized, and stains ≠ dirt, but it stained pretty much immediately to a sort of dark, rusty brown and no amount of boiling and scrubbing with soapy water will get it out. doesn’t affect the performance at all, but it does look ugly, and i wish they offered options in darker colors just so it didn’t look so gross— anything that comes into prolonged contact with blood is obviously going to stain, and it seems a little counterintuitive to make said object in a light color :) overall, still highly recommend for form and function, and specifically the lily cup for its unique shape. i will never be going back!”

“I was having trouble doing #1 (peeing) with my regular menstrual cup. Some random forum suggested this cup, since it doesn't have the usual protruding rim that most menstrual cups have. I was reading the specs on this cup and that it's good for a higher cervix. Had no clue about that but measured myself and turns out I do have a pretty high one (which would explain my regular menstrual cup getting "sucked up" into my vagina and generally needing to be a bit explorative to take it out lol). Anyways, there's a bit of a learning curve as far as insertion and removal works, but dang I wore this thing for 12 hours straight, no leaks, no problem. Best part? I could pee without difficulty, unlike before! Be forewarned, the ridged grip stem at the end was too long for me, so I trimmed it back :) Thank you Intimina!”
